“Mask Vs Face”
A new group exhibition “Mask Vs Face”
curated by Zhang Zhaohui will be held at Red Gate
Gallery from June 22 to July 14.
A person's face is a living ID card readout
of the content of his or her life. The face directly expresses a person's
experience, education, depth, and style, as well as psychological and material
conditions. We remember or recognise a person primarily because of the
impression made on us by his or her individual look.
This group show features more than
30 works by Wang
Jinsong, Tammy Wong, Li Haibing, Cang Xin, Feng Zhenjie, Chen Ke, Li Wei, Shen
Ruijun, Liu Wei, Hong Hao, Sheng Qi, Shu Yong, Shu Jie, Dai Xiuzhen, Jin Feng
and Dai Guangyu. This exhibition focuses on the artists
own or others' faces and examines the complex relations between masks and
faces. These works suggest the artists' individual strategies for active
involvement in contemporary social life as well as artistic visual information
on urban development and social transformation.
